One of the most recognizable faces in Indian news is Arnab Goswami. Known for his fiery debate style and assertive questioning, Goswami has been a prominent figure for years. He has worked with various news channels, and he currently runs his own channel, Republic TV. His shows are known for their high-energy discussions and debates on current affairs. Another very popular news anchor is Ravish Kumar. With his calm demeanor and focus on social issues, Kumar has built a loyal following. He is known for his critical analysis of government policies and his strong advocacy for the common people. He is known for his shows on NDTV India, where he covered everything from politics to social issues. He has received numerous awards for his contribution to journalism. He is also known for his focus on social issues. The next famous anchor is Sreenivasan Jain. A senior journalist and anchor, Jain is known for his balanced reporting and his insightful analysis of complex issues. He has worked with NDTV for many years and is known for his in-depth interviews and investigative reports. He has reported on a wide range of issues, from politics to economics to social issues. He is also known for his ability to explain complex issues in a clear and concise manner. Let's not forget Anjana Om Kashyap. She is a well-known news anchor, and she is known for her strong opinions and her ability to engage with her audience. She is known for her shows on Aaj Tak and is known for her debates on various current affairs topics. These anchors are the leaders in India's top daily news.

Leading News Channels and Their Anchors
Let's get into some of the leading news channels in India and highlight the anchors who make them shine. Each channel has its own style and focus, reflecting its editorial stance and target audience. Understanding which channels are associated with which anchors helps viewers navigate the diverse news landscape. There are a lot of top anchors in the country. Let's break down some of the top news channels and who anchors for them.
- NDTV: NDTV is known for its focus on in-depth reporting and balanced coverage. It has been a prominent force in Indian journalism for many years. It is known for its news shows and interviews. It also has a lot of anchors that are very famous. Some of the most recognizable anchors for NDTV include Sreenivasan Jain and Marya Shakil. These anchors bring expertise and insight to the channel's coverage of current affairs. The network is known for its detailed analysis and its commitment to covering a wide range of issues. NDTV's anchors are often seen as thought leaders in the industry. They are known for their in-depth interviews and their coverage of complex topics. They play a crucial role in bringing the news to the public.
- Aaj Tak: Aaj Tak is a popular Hindi-language news channel. It is known for its fast-paced coverage and its focus on breaking news. It has a huge audience and is a leading source of news for many people. The channel's anchors, like Anjana Om Kashyap, are well-known for their direct style and their ability to engage with the audience. Aaj Tak anchors are often seen as being close to the people. They focus on delivering the news in a clear and concise manner. The channel's style is dynamic, and its anchors are known for their high-energy delivery.
- India Today: India Today is a well-respected English and Hindi news channel. Known for its comprehensive coverage and its diverse range of news stories, it attracts a wide audience. The channel employs anchors like Rajdeep Sardesai, known for their insightful analysis and expertise on current affairs. India Today's anchors bring a depth of knowledge to their reporting. They provide in-depth analysis of complex topics, and they are committed to providing balanced coverage. They offer a blend of news and views. They are known for their professionalism and their commitment to providing accurate and reliable information.
- Republic TV: Republic TV is a popular English news channel. Known for its assertive style and its focus on debates, it has quickly gained a large audience. The channel is known for its high-energy discussions and its focus on breaking news. It has many anchors, including Arnab Goswami, known for their strong opinions and their ability to engage with the audience. Republic TV's anchors are known for their passion and their directness.
